小红书前端安全风控一面


  1. 大致的学习路线
  2. 介绍一下项目
  3. vue框架和原生有什么区别
  4. vue框架做了什么?好处是?
  5. vue中绑定节点的原理
  6. 项目的设计模式
  7. 反诈通这个项目实现的功能和板块
  8. 对于提升项目加载速度和运行效率是怎么做的
  9. webpack能做什么优化,具体的优化是什么
  10. webpackvite的区别
  11. nodejs用来干什么,作用是什么
  12. express模块可以做什么
  13. vue3vue2的区别
  14. objext.definepropertyproxy的原理和区别
  15. websocket的你是用来做什么,说说具体的做法
  16. 了解http吗?详细说一下
  17. websockethttp的区别
  18. 有学过java吗?有用java 进行编程吗?详细说一下你对他的了解
  19. vuexpinia的区别
  20. 前端工程化

算法题:大数之和(两个大数进行相加)




#前端实习准备##小红书面试##攒人品##前端八股#
全部评论
兄弟过了嘛
点赞 回复 分享
发布于 2024-07-08 14:29 江西
安全风控还在招吗
点赞 回复 分享
发布于 2024-07-06 23:50 宁夏

相关推荐

虾皮前端一面总结一、八股文考察1. 箭头函数◦ 核心问题:需明确箭头函数特性(无this、arguments、prototype,不能用new)。◦ 未答关键点:◦ this继承自外层词法作用域,非构造函数因无prototype且new时无法绑定this。◦ new过程需创建实例、绑定this、返回实例,箭头函数无[[Construct]]内部方法。2. 性能优化◦ 问题:不熟悉相关知识,需补充学习(如防抖节流、SSR、CDN、懒加载等)。3. 浏览器内存与缓存◦ Local/Session Storage:数据存储于磁盘,读取时从内存缓存或磁盘获取(取决于是否常驻内存)。◦ 协商缓存:◦ max-age=0与no-cache区别:前者强制验证缓存,后者需服务器确认。◦ ETag与Last-Modified并存:前者更精准(文件内容变化),后者依赖时间戳(可能误判)。4. React Hook◦ 问题:对useMemo、useCallback、memo使用场景模糊。◦ 改进点:结合项目举例(如子组件高频渲染时用memo缓存,避免函数重复创建导致的重渲染)。二、代码题• 动态规划背包问题:用最少砝码数量组合目标重量,需明确状态转移方程(如dp[i] = min(dp[i], dp[i - w] + 1))。三、面试官交流1. AI看法:强调合理利用AI辅助解决复杂问题,提升效率。2. 性能优化建议:结合具体场景(如电商首屏优化、可视化图表性能),参考谷歌Lighthouse、Web Vitals等工具。四、改进方向1. 基础巩固:深入理解箭头函数原理、浏览器存储机制、HTTP缓存策略。2. 性能专题:系统学习优化手段,结合实际项目案例分析。3. React实践:梳理Hook使用场景,通过项目练习巩固(如列表渲染优化)。4. 算法训练:强化动态规划题型,掌握背包问题变种解法。
点赞 评论 收藏
分享
评论
5
14
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务